Split type down lamp
Technical Field
The utility model relates to a LED lamp technical field specifically is a split type down lamp.
Background
An LED, a light emitting diode, is a solid semiconductor device capable of converting electric energy into visible light, which can directly convert electricity into light, the heart of the LED is a semiconductor wafer, one end of the wafer is attached to a support, the other end is a cathode, and the other end is connected with the anode of a power supply, so that the whole wafer is encapsulated by epoxy resin.
The down lamp belongs to one kind of LED lamp, and at present, the down lamp on the existing market is mostly the integral type structure, not only is not convenient for install and dismantle, is unfavorable for the maintenance and the maintenance in later stage moreover, easily leads to the down lamp to take place to damage, has reduced the life of down lamp, has caused the waste of resource and the loss of property.

Referring to fig. 1-3, a split type down lamp comprises a housing 1, a base 2 fixedly connected to the top of the inner cavity of the housing 1, fixed frames 3 fixedly connected to the bottoms of both sides of the inner cavity of the housing 1, a fixed frame 4 movably connected to the inner cavity of the fixed frame 3, a spring 5 fixedly connected between one side of the fixed frame 4 and the fixed frame 3, a stop 6 fixedly connected to the other side of the fixed frame 4, connecting rods 7 fixedly connected to the bottoms of both sides of the inner cavity of the housing 1 and above the fixed frame 3, an inner cavity of the connecting rods 7 movably connected to the fixed frame 4, a top rod 8 fixedly connected to the top of the inner cavity of the fixed frame 4, an electromagnet 9 fixedly connected to the bottom of the top rod 8, a control switch 10 provided at the bottom of one side of the housing 1, the control switch 10 electrically connected to the electromagnet 9, a lamp head 14 movably connected to the inner cavity of the housing 1, and iron blocks 17 fixedly connected to both sides of the top of the lamp head 14, the lamp holder 14 is provided with limiting holes 18 on both sides, the housing 1 extrudes the stop block 6 by inserting the lamp holder 14 into the inner cavity of the housing 1, the stop block 6 extrudes the fixing frame 4, the fixing frame 4 extrudes the spring 5, the spring 5 is extruded to generate a reverse force, when the limiting holes 18 move to the same horizontal line of the stop block 6, the fixing frame 4 is pushed by the rebound force of the spring 5 to move, the fixing frame 4 pushes the stop block 6 to move, so that the housing 1 and the lamp holder 14 are clamped, the electromagnet 9 is electrified to generate magnetism by opening the control switch 10, the electromagnet 9 moves towards the direction of the iron block 17, the electromagnet 9 drives the ejector rod 8 to move, the ejector rod 8 drives the fixing frame 4 to move, the stop block 6 is drawn away from the inner cavity of the limiting holes 18 by matching use of the connecting rod 7, thereby the lamp holder 14 is disassembled, the purpose of convenient installation and disassembly is realized, and the practicability and the usability of the device are improved, the use that has strengthened the user is experienced, has solved down lamp on the current market and has mostly the integral type structure, not only is not convenient for install and dismantle, is unfavorable for the maintenance and the maintenance in later stage moreover, easily leads to down lamp to take place to damage, has reduced the life of down lamp, has caused the problem of the waste of resource and the loss of property.
In this embodiment, specifically, the top of the casing 1 is fixedly connected with the connecting seat 11, the inner cavity of the connecting seat 11 is movably connected with the connecting plate 12, and the fixing rod 13 is movably connected between the two connecting plates 12, and the casing 1 can be conveniently installed by setting the connecting seat 11, the connecting plate 12 and the fixing rod 13.
In this embodiment, specific, the spacing groove has all been seted up to the both sides of connecting seat 11, and the inner chamber sliding connection of spacing groove has the stopper, and one side and the connecting plate 12 fixed connection of stopper, through setting up spacing groove and stopper for cooperation connecting plate 12 uses.
In this embodiment, specifically, an opening 15 is opened on one side of the fixing frame 3 away from the housing 1, and a through hole 16 is opened at the top of the housing 1, and is used for being matched with the stopper 6 through the opening 15 and matched with the fixing frame 4 through the through hole 16.
In this embodiment, specifically, a hole is formed in the bottom of the housing 1, and the hole is used for placing the lamp holder 14.
When the lamp holder 14 is used, the lamp holder 14 is inserted into the inner cavity of the shell 1, the shell 1 extrudes the stop block 6, the stop block 6 extrudes the fixing frame 4, the fixing frame 4 extrudes the spring 5, the spring 5 is extruded to generate reverse force, when the limit hole 18 moves to the same horizontal line of the stop block 6, the rebound force of the spring 5 pushes the fixing frame 4 to move, the fixing frame 4 pushes the stop block 6 to move, so that the shell 1 and the lamp holder 14 are clamped, when the lamp holder 14 needs to be disassembled, the electromagnet 9 is electrified to generate magnetism by opening the control switch 10, the electromagnet 9 moves towards the direction of the iron block 17, the electromagnet 9 drives the ejector rod 8 to move, the ejector rod 8 drives the fixing frame 4 to move, the stop block 6 is drawn away from the inner cavity of the limit hole 18 by matching use of the connecting rod 7, so as to disassemble the lamp holder 14, and through the connecting seat 11, the connecting plate 12 and the fixing rod 13, the down lamp fixing structure is used for installing the shell 1, achieves the purpose of being convenient to install and detach, solves the problem that down lamps in the existing market are mostly of an integrated structure, is not convenient to install and detach, is not beneficial to overhaul and maintenance in the later period, is easy to damage, reduces the service life of the down lamps, and causes resource waste and property loss.
